Passage 1Three men traveling on a train began a conversation about the world’s greatest wonders.“In my opinion,” the first man said, “the Egyptian pyramids(埃及金字塔)are the world’s greatestwonder. Although they were built thousands of years ago, they are still standing. And remember: thepeople who built them had only simple tools. They did not have the kind of machinery that buildersand engineers have today.”“I agree that the pyramids in Egypt are wonderful,” the second man said, “but I do not think theyare the greatest wonder. I believe computers are more wonderful than the pyramids. They have takenpeople to the moon and brought them back safely. In seconds, they carry out mathematicalcalculations that would take a person a hundred years to do.”He turned to the third man and asked, “What do you think is the greatest wonder in the world?”The third man thought for a long time, and then he said, “Well, I agree that the pyramids arewonderful, and I agree that computers are wonderful, too. However, in my opinion, the mostwonderful thing in the world is this thermos.”And he took a thermos out of his bag and held it up.The other two men were very surprised. “A thermos?” they exclaimed. “But that’s a simplething.”“Oh, no, it’s not,” the third man said. “In the winter you put in a hot drink and it stays hot. In thesummer you put in a cold drink and it stays cold. How does the thermos know whether it’s winter orsummer?”6.
